Claude Fable 5

Claude Fable 5 and Claude Mythos 5

Summary

Claude Fable 5 is a Mythos-class model designed for general use, surpassing previous models in capabilities. It demonstrates exceptional performance across various benchmarks, particularly in software engineering, knowledge work, vision, and scientific research, with greater advantages in longer and more complex tasks.

Key Takeaways

  • Claude Fable 5 is a Mythos-class model that outperforms all previous models in software engineering, knowledge work, vision, and scientific research.
  • Fable 5 has been launched with safeguards that limit its use in sensitive areas, triggering alternative responses from the Claude Opus 4.8 model in less than 5% of sessions.
  • Claude Mythos 5, a variant of Fable 5, has lifted safeguards for a select group of cyberdefenders and infrastructure providers, offering the strongest cybersecurity capabilities of any model.
  • Fable 5 and Mythos 5 are priced at $10 per million input tokens and $50 per million output tokens, significantly lower than the previous Claude Mythos Preview.

Community Sentiment

Positive

Positives

  • Fable 5 demonstrates a significant leap in performance, achieving a 29.3% score on the FrontierCode benchmark, indicating its superior coding capabilities compared to previous models.
  • Users report Fable 5's ability to tackle complex problems efficiently, often using fewer tokens than its predecessor, which enhances cost-effectiveness for developers.
  • The frontend design of Fable 5 has been praised for its intentional crafting and improved usability, making it more delightful for end-users.
  • Fable 5 has shown remarkable proficiency in handling intricate tasks, such as reverse engineering and analyzing dense specifications, which were challenging for earlier models.

Concerns

  • The removal of Fable 5 from subscription plans after a promotional period raises concerns about accessibility and potential hidden costs for users.
  • Some users experienced significant token consumption, leading to frustration over unexpected costs and limitations on their usage.
  • There are worries that Anthropic's restrictions on model usage for competitive development may stifle innovation and limit developers' capabilities in building advanced AI applications.
